The Historical Reasons Behind European Migration to North America

2026-06-13 18:45:59 发布

The Historical Reasons Behind European Migration to North America,Religious Freedom and Persecution ,One of the primary reasons for European migration to North America during the early colonial era was the pursuit of religious freedom. Many, such as the Pilgrims in the 17th century, fled Europe due to religious persecution, seeking a land where they could freely practice their beliefs without fear of persecution. The promise of tolerance in the New World, exemplified by the Mayflower Compact, drew them towards the shores of the Americas.

一、Political Instability and Economic Opportunity
Europes political landscape was often marked by instability, with wars and revolutions creating unrest. The American Revolution offered a chance for people to escape the Old Worlds conflicts and seek economic opportunities. The fertile soil and vast expanses of North America promised new beginnings for farmers, craftsmen, and entrepreneurs alike, leading to waves of migration from countries like England, Ireland, and Germany.

二、Technological Advancements and Agricultural Expansion
Technological advancements in agriculture, like the horse-drawn plow and improved farming techniques, made it possible for Europeans to settle in previously uncharted territories. The transatlantic crossing facilitated by the Industrial Revolution also made transportation more accessible, enabling larger numbers of people to migrate. The Homestead Act of 1862 in the United States, which offered free land to settlers, further fueled this migration trend.

三、Social Mobility and Cultural Exchange
North Americas relative openness to newcomers allowed for social mobility that was not always available in Europe. Immigrants had the chance to rise through the ranks based on merit, rather than birthright, providing a pathway to upward mobility. Additionally, cultural exchange between Europe and North America was enriched, as diverse European traditions blended with indigenous cultures, shaping the continents unique identity.

In conclusion, a complex interplay of religious, political, economic, and technological factors drove European migration to North America. This movement not only reshaped the continents but also left a lasting impact on the development of both societies, forming the foundation for the multicultural fabric we see today.
